    win 7 install error


    i cannot upgrade install win 7
    first after a blue screen of death i restarted my system but on bootup screen disply was rotated to 90 degree left with th msg "interactive logon process initialzation failed...." i tried many options like restore, image backup restore, safemode, last known good configuration but nothing worked. somehow i didnt have system restore or backup images. i am using this laptop since july. in safe mode screen display is upright but with the same message.
    then i tried booting via cmd to run sfc scan but couldnt find away to do it. then i down loaded win 7 image from digital content river and converted my 8 gb flash in to bootable to in place upgrade instal. first i tried to repair it via bootable usb using every known way but all in vain. than i tried in place upgrade instal, it gave me device drivers not found error, after a lot of digging i used usb 2 port for the flash and the error msg was gone. but then after a few steps it told me to take out installation media restart normally and then insert it again to start installation which i did but the the early boot screen gave error and the installation didnt start, i played all the cards in my leeves but still clueless
